Eligible Ford EV and PHEV Models
As of 2025, the following Ford vehicles may qualify for a portion or the full amount of the federal EV tax credit, depending on specific trim level, battery components, and assembly location:
- 2024–2025 Ford F-150 Lightning: Select configurations of this all-electric pickup meet the eligibility requirements, making it a great option for those seeking both performance and savings.
- 2024–2025 Ford Mustang Mach-E: Some trims of this stylish electric SUV may qualify, especially those that meet the critical mineral and battery content rules under the Inflation Reduction Act.
- 2024–2025 Ford Escape Plug-In Hybrid: This plug-in hybrid crossover may be eligible for a partial credit, depending on battery sourcing and final assembly.
Please note: eligibility can vary based on VIN, specific trim, MSRP limits, and individual taxpayer criteria. It’s best to consult with a tax professional or contact Helfman Ford directly.
